Jango9 wrote:The EHX website was once the home of the first ever dedicated BoC page, and as such it hosted quite a bit of media. There is a mirror of the page itself on the Wayback Machine, but it's horribly incomplete as most of archive.org's captures were made after the site itself had vanished.
This page in particular sparks a lot of interest. The clips of Duffy, Wouldn't You Like To Be Free, and Circle originally came from here (and have made the rounds since then, to the frustration of people who want to hear the entire tracks), but there's a few other points of interest here. The proof of the live Chinook from 1997 is here, but the actual audio seems to have gone AWOL.
BOCpages also says that some of the Super 8 footage that they used live is here and the directory structure indicates that many, many still pictures didn't get saved. Has anyone got anything that was once hosted here besides the 3 aforementioned clips?
